Built around the 140-grain ELD Match bullet, the Hornady Match 6.5 Creedmoor load (brand part no. 81500) was one of the loads that helped put 6.5 Creedmoor on the map for long-range shooters. The Extremely Low Drag Match bullet pairs a boat-tail base with a slick polymer tip, giving it a ballistic coefficient that resists wind drift better than traditional match bullets. Hornady loads it as a centerfire cartridge with brass cases, so ignition stays dependable across bolt guns, gas guns, and PRS rigs alike. Every lot is checked for consistent powder charges and seating depth before it leaves the plant, the kind of attention that turns a rifle’s mechanical accuracy into results on paper. For shooters chasing a proven load in rifle ammunition, the 140-grain ELD Match is a known quantity.

Frequently Asked Questions
What makes the ELD Match bullet different from a standard boat-tail? The polymer tip and secant ogive profile of the ELD Match hold a higher ballistic coefficient than typical boat-tail bullets, reducing wind drift at distance.
Does this load use a centerfire primer? Yes, it is a standard centerfire cartridge compatible with bolt-action and semi-automatic 6.5 Creedmoor rifles.
